To interact with an OPC server, you need to create toolbox objects. You create an OPC Data Access Client (opcda client) object to provide a connection to a particular OPC server. You then create one or more Data Access Groups (dagroup objects) to control sets of Data Access Items (daitem objects), which represent links to server items. OPC Toolbox objects are described in more detail in Understanding the OPC Toolbox Object Hierarchy.
This chapter describes how to create and configure toolbox objects to interact with an OPC server. Reading, Writing, and Logging OPC Data provides information on how to use the OPC Toolbox objects to exchange data with an OPC server.
